Finca Vigía, Hemingway’s white pillared Cuban mansion pokes out of the greenery surrounding it looking old, mildewed and of another great era. Hemingway lived in this house for 22 years and it still contains his collection of 9,000+ books, his papers, letters and manuscripts, his clothes, his furniture, photos and other effects from his time there. Open as a museum since Hemingway’s death, the villa is now in need of repair but still offers an excellent insight into the life of this great man and the gnarled ties between Cuba and the US.
